基于MySQL的学籍管理系统设计与实现
需积分: 0 74 浏览量
更新于2024-08-04
收藏 1.18MB DOCX 举报
在本篇文档中,主要探讨的是如何基于队友提供的E-R图和转换图设计数据库以及选择合适的数据库管理系统。首先,设计者强调了基本表的重要性,这些表如图1所示,它们符合关系型数据库的结构,如MySQL、SQLServer、Oracle、Sybase、DB2等,这些数据库通常面向企业应用,采取收费模式。然而,出于成本和开发效率的考量,文档选择MySQL作为数据库平台。
MySQL被选中的理由包括它是开源的,用户无需支付额外费用;它能够处理大规模数据库,支持上千万条记录;使用标准SQL语言,具有跨平台和多语言支持,特别适合PHP这种流行的Web开发语言。此外,MySQL支持大型数据仓库,提供不同版本的适应性,如文档中提到的MySQL Ver.8.0.20 for Win64 on x86_64。
接下来的步骤是使用SQL语句在MySQL上创建数据库和数据表,以及导入模拟的数据,具体数据如图2所示。值得注意的是,开发重点在于实现学籍管理系统的功能,因此关注管理员权限的管理,以及用户界面的设计,以提供友好的操作体验。
在IDEA开发环境中,开发者采用Java编写代码,实现用户对数据库中数据的操作,比如系统登录、学生管理、课程管理、成绩管理以及系统退出等功能。因为目标是管理员端的程序开发,所以权限设置集中在这部分。为了提升用户体验,文档强调了图形界面设计的友好性,使用户能够轻松地进行数据访问和操作,体现了项目的人性化设计原则。整个过程注重实用性与效率,确保数据库管理和应用程序的有效集成。
点击了解资源详情
点击了解资源详情
256 浏览量
2023-07-30 上传
2024-04-13 上传
2021-09-10 上传
兰若芊薇
- 粉丝: 31
- 资源: 301